It is an anti-rust primer containing high-quality pigment and alkyd resin, providing excellent rust protection. It applies smoothly and adheres well to metal surfaces.
The steel surface to ensure it is free from oil, grease, rust, salts, dust, and other contaminants that may affect paint adhesion.
Clean the surface using suitable solvents or industrial degreasers to remove all traces of oil and grease. Wipe down with clean rags soaked in thinner if necessary.
Perform abrasive blasting to achieve ISO 8501-1 Sa 2.5 or SSPC- SP 10 (Near White Metal Blast Cleaning) for optimal cleanliness. If blasting is not possible, use mechanical cleaning tools (e.g., wire brushing, grinding) to meet ISO 8501-1 St 3 (Very Thorough Manual Cleaning).
NEOCOAT PRIMER 5000 Dft. 50 microns
NEOGLOSS ENAMEL COLOR Dft. 60 microns
The surface to be painted should have a temperature between 10–50°C, and the relative humidity should not exceed 85%.
HANDLING AND STORAGE :
The product must be stored in accordance with national regulations. Keep the containers in a dry, cool, well ventilated space and away from source of heat and ignition. Containers must be kept tightly closed.
Shelf Life 2 years
Packing 0.757 Ltr. / 3.785 Ltr. / 18.925 Ltr.
HEALTH AND SAFETY :
Please observe the precautionary notices displayed on the container. Use under well ventilated conditions. Do not breathe or inhale mist. Avoid skin contact. Spillage on the skin should immediately be removed with suitable cleanser, soap and water. Eyes should be well flushed with water and medical attention sought immediately.
| Type | Alkyd-Based Anti-Rust Primer |
| Color | Red oxide / Grey / White |
| Film Appearance | Semi - Gloss |
| Solid Content (%) | 65±2 |
| Flash Point | 40°C |
| Specific Gravity | 1.74±0.05 |
| Wet Film Thickness | 77 microns |
| Dry Film Thickness | 50 microns |
| Theoretical Coverage | 13 sqm. / Ltr. @ 50 microns Remark: The actual paint coverage may vary depending on the surface condition, mixing ratio, environmental conditions during application, application methods and techniques, as well as the structure and size of the object to be coated. |
